Based on the work shown by the student, we can analyze the steps taken and the conclusion reached.
-
The original equation simplified down to \( 5x + 2 = 5x + 2 \). This kind of equality indicates that both sides of the equation are identical for any value of \( x \).
-
Since both sides are the same, this indicates that there are infinite solutions to the equation. In other words, no matter what value \( x \) takes, the equation will hold true.
Answer:
- The student solved the equation correctly because the original equation has infinite solutions.
